Had dinner there which I thought was very pricey and small in portions and tasted very plain and bland compared to most other indian resturants that I have eaten in.The interior decor and table presentation is very plain, the lady server was very polite but the male was very blunt and not very welcoming I will not be revisiting that establishment again.

Went to see a show so not from the area, therefore picked The Banyan Tree by chance. Was it super fast and hurried, no. Was it freshly made and extremely delicious, yes. Absolutely lovely food, probably top 3 curries I've ever had. Thank you, will be back for certain!!

We had a lovely meal here, we booked for 6pm on a Friday and it was quiet in the restaurant, i can imagine it gets quite busy later on. The people serving were very friendly and helpful. Food was great. Nice relaxed atmosphere with Indian music in the background. There was a small car park at the back. Will definitely go again.

Tasty curry but only 4 small pieces of meat per curry is hardl value for money, kept waiting 20 minutes to order then another 45 minutes before food ready. Appreciate it takes time to cook but i was the only customer in the restaurant foyer.Definitely definitely not worth the money.

Very friendly welcome and great service throughout , didn't feel rushed or pressured, the staff are happy and patient and allow you to enjoy your dining experience. Most importantly the food is incredible, I highly recommend the mixed starter for 2 first time I've ever had fish in an Indian restaurant (WOW!!) Will definitely be back!!!!!Parking: Small parking area around the back of restaurant
